Abstract

We report fractional orbital angular momentum (OAM) dense mode-division multiplexing (DMDM) assisted by 2×2 MIMO equalization in free-space optical communications. Fractional OAM multiplexing communications even with a small OAM channel spacing of 0.2 are demonstrated in the experiment.
